The Importance of a Driving License

A driving license is essential for numerous factors:

  1. Legal Authorization: It grants the holder the legal right to drive, ensuring compliance with traffic laws and regulations.
  2. Recognition: A driving license works as a form of recognition, often asked for by authorities in many scenarios like banking or travel.
  3. Insurance Rates: Many vehicle insurance coverage service providers need a valid driving license as a requirement for supplying coverage. A driver's history effects premiums, which implies that getting a license can potentially lower insurance coverage expenses if the person has a clean driving record.
  4. Employment Opportunities: For particular tasks, specifically those needing travel or transportation, having a valid driving license is often a prerequisite.
  5. Independence and Convenience: A driving license offers people with the capability to travel easily without counting on public transport or others for rides.

Types of Driving Licenses

Driving licenses are frequently classified into different types based upon vehicle operation capabilities and legal restraints. Below is a list of some common license types:

  • Learner's Permit: This is given to new motorists for practice under the supervision of an experienced motorist.
  • Full License: This allows the holder to drive individually without limitations.
  • Industrial Driver's License (CDL): Required for driving bigger lorries like trucks and buses.
  • Bike License: Specially created for individuals wanting to operate bikes.
  • International Driving Permit (IDP): Created for travelers to drive in foreign nations, supplied they have a legitimate domestic driving license.

Acquiring a Driving License: The Process

The procedure of obtaining a driving license varies from country to country, but generally involves a number of common steps. Here's an overview of the procedure:

  1. Eligibility Check: Ensure that you satisfy the age and other requirements set by the licensing authority.
  2. Written Exam: Pass a composed test concentrating on rules of the roadway, traffic signals, and security policies.
  3. Motorist's Education Course: Many places need new chauffeurs to finish a motorist's education course, which consists of behind-the-wheel training.
  4. Vision Test: Undergo a vision screening to guarantee you meet the necessary standards to drive.
  5. Roadway Test: Successfully pass a useful driving test to show your capability to follow traffic laws and drive securely.
  6. Issuance of License: Upon successful completion of all tests and conference requirements, the driving license will be issued.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How long does it take to obtain a driving license?

A: The duration can differ depending on the country and the individual's preparation level. Typically, it can take anywhere from a couple of weeks to a number of months, specifically if attending a driving school.

Q2: Can I drive with a learner's authorization?

A: Yes, however just when accompanied by a certified, accredited adult driver in the car, based on the rules for learner's authorizations.

Q3: What should I do if my driving license is lost or stolen?

A: Report it to the appropriate authorities right away and request a replacement through your regional motor automobile administration.

Q4: Are there age requirements for obtaining a driving license?

A: Yes, many jurisdictions require individuals to be a minimum of 16 or 18 years of ages to get a complete driving license, but learners' authorizations might be available at a younger age.

Q5: Can a driving license be withdrawed?

A: Yes, a license can be withdrawed due to different reasons such as duplicated traffic infractions, driving under the influence, or failure to abide by insurance requirements.
